Common Juniper Juniperus communis var. alpina - Bio
Aromatic molecules: β-phellandrene, α-pinene, limonene, acetate terpenyl
Extracted from: twig and berries
This bushy shrub common in mountainous areas, moors and clearings throughout the northern hemisphere has very narrow leaves ending in a sharp point. The berries are globular, first green, then bluish black and covered with wax maturity.
